Other Public Administration is the 279th most popular major in the country with 588 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, other public administration gra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$46,889 and had an average of $22,079 in loans still to pay off.

Across Massachusetts, there were 50 other public administration graduates with average earnings and debt of $47,640 and $6,300 respectively.

Boston University
Boston, Massachusetts

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Boston University.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Most Veteran Friendly in Massachusetts for Other Public Admin for a Master’s list. Boston U is a private not-for-profit institution located in Boston, Massachusetts. The school has a large population, and it awarded 5 masters’s degrees in 2020-2021.

Boston U also took the #1 spot in our “Best Other Public Administration Master’s Degree Schools in Massachusetts” ranking.According to our most recent data, Boston U supports 32,718 students, and 15 of those are GI Bill® students, of which 1 are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$25,162. To help with additional expenses, 0 students received funds through the Yellow Ribbon Program.

Tufts University
Medford, Massachusetts

Out of the 2 schools in the Most Veteran Friendly in Massachusetts for Other Public Admin for a Master’s that were part of this year’s ranking, Tufts University landed the #2 spot on the list. Located in Medford, Massachusetts, this fairly large private not-for-profit school awarded 12 degrees to qualified masters’s other public admin students in 2020-2021.

Tufts not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Other Public Administration Master’s Degree Schools in Massachusetts” list.Of the 12,219 students enrolled at Tufts University, 1 were GI Bill® students, according to our most recent data. Out of that number, 0 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average tuition and fees award for the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ients was $0. In addition to receiving other benefits, 0 students received scholarships through the Yellow Ribbon Program.
